Zyp Technologies Secures $1.5M to Launch EVs with Battery Swap Stations in Pakistan

Zyp Technologies has successfully raised $1.5 million in Series Pre-A funding, led by Shorooq Partners, to expand its electric vehicle infrastructure in Lahore, Pakistan.

  • Infrastructure Development: Zyp Technologies will establish over 60 battery swap stations and deploy 1,000 Zyp Utility Motorcycles (ZUM 2000) within the next 12 months.

  • Support for EV Policy: This launch supports Pakistan’s National Electric Vehicle Policy, which targets EVs to make up 30% of all vehicles sold by 2030.

  • Manufacturing Capacity: The company has set up an assembly line capable of producing up to 12,000 electric motorcycles per year.

  • Regional Expansion: Zyp aims to expand its operations to other Gulf nations, including the United Arab Emirates, by 2025.

  • Investment Benefits: The funding from Shorooq Partners is expected to yield significant environmental and economic benefits for Pakistan.

Zyp Technologies is set to be a major player in Pakistan’s shift towards electric vehicles, promoting eco-friendly and innovative urban transportation solutions.
